ÍNDICE
- Visão Geral
- Exemplo de utilização
01. VISÃO GERAL
O Metadados
Produto | : | Framework Versão: 11.82, 12.1 |
Processo | : | Metadados |
Subprocesso | : | Incluindo um projeto |
Data da publicação | : | 14/10/2013 |
Introdução
...
permite ao usuário a criação e desenvolvimento visual de lógicas de negócio com o objetivo de estender a solução TOTVS RM.
A ideia é criar um mecanismo de geração automática de formulários através da utilização de um dicionário de dados fornecendo um modelo de persistência, negócio e apresentação, facilitando a transformação de dados em informações que ajudem no processo de tomada de decisão das organizações que utilizam o ERP Linha RM.
Conceito: O Metadados consiste em uma interface para usuários para criação, consulta, atualização e destruição de dados. Esse é o propósito final de um projeto de Metadados.
...
Aviso |
---|
|
A Partir das versões abaixo todos os projetos de metadados serão incluídos no arquivo _BrokerCustom.dat ao invés do _Broker.dat 12.1.2209 | 12.1.2205.142 | 12.1.34.206 |
|
02. EXEMPLO DE UTILIZAÇÃO
Como exemplo vamos criar um Projeto de
Projeto para cadastro de FUNCIONÁRIOS utilizando dependentes
...
CADASTRO DE FUNCIONÁRIOS RELACIONANDO COM DEPENDENTES
...
.
Informações |
---|
|
Deck of Cards |
---|
| Card |
---|
| Incluindo Tipo de dados: |
|
|
...
Para iniciarmos o projeto será necessário cadastrar os tipos de dados, para isto siga os passos abaixo seguindo a planilha disponibilizada com os tipos de dados. Image Modified |
|
|
...
- Cadastrar os tipos de dados abaixo:
|
|
|
...
SQL | Tipo Oracle | Tipo Linguagem | Inteiro | int | number(10,0) | System.Int32 | Varchar | varchar | varchar2 | System.String | Data | datetime | date | System.DateTime | Inteiro Curto | smallint | number(5,0) | System.Int16 | String | varchar | varchar2 | System.String | Moeda | money | NUMBER(10,2) | System.Decimal | Char | char(1) | char(1) | System.Char | Memo | TEXT | clob | System.String | Imagem | IMAGE | blob | System.Byte[] |
|
|
|
...
INCLUINDO TABELAS
Card |
---|
| Incluindo Tabela: A segunda etapa é a criação das tabelas que serão utilizadas no projeto. Execute o processo de acordo com a figura. Image Modified |
|
|
...
Ao acessar a tela inclua os dados respectivos a esta tabela seguindo os exemplos abaixo: |
|
|
...
TABELA DE FUNCIONÁRIO
Image Removed
Card |
---|
| Tabela de Funcionário: Image Added |
Card |
---|
| Tabela de Dependente: |
|
|
...
Image Modified Aviso |
---|
Quando utilizado o preenchimento automático em um campo novo,na alteração de uma tabela, é necessário o preenchimento do campo "Valor Padrão" |
|
|
|
INCLUINDO RELACIONAMENTO
Card |
---|
| Incluindo Relacionamento: |
|
|
...
Esta funcionalidade possibilitará relacionar as tabelas criadas no metadados. Image Modified Ao selecionarmos a tabela filha campo IDFUNC (Tabela ZMDDependente) e a tabela pai (ZMDFUNCIONARIO) campo IDFUNC, estabelecemos um relacionamento entre as tabelas através desses campos. Image Modified Todas as definições como configurações de campo e relacionamentos já pré-estabelecidos no modelo de persistência servirão como base para a criação do modelo de negócio, seguindo o conceito de herança. Neste ponto será possível escolher quais os campos de um objeto de persistência serão utilizados no DataServer além de permitir criar novos campos que serão considerados como campos calculados.
|
|
|
...
Para mais informações, acesse: Criando um relacionamento entre tabelas de Metadados
Aviso |
---|
É importante frisar que a FK só é criada na criação da tabela após a primeira geração do projeto. Desse modo, não é possível fazer a alteração de um FK em uma tabela já existente. |
|
Card |
---|
| Incluindo modelo de Negócio: Image Modified
Image Modified A tela será apresentada com as tabelas relacionadas na seguinte estrutura: Image Modified |
|
|
...
Card |
---|
| Incluindo Formulários: Image Modified Através da GUIA Apresentação é possível definir funções que serão apresentadas na TELA que será criada como Exemplos: caixa de pesquisa, caixa de Seleção, caixa de opção etc. No exemplo iremos trabalhar com o campo CODCOLIGADA e iremos utilizar caixa de seleção onde estaremos utilizando os itens do cadastro de coligadas. Este recurso proporcionará realizar pesquisas no cadastro de coligadas quando selecionado (Após a inclusão do metadado) Image Modified |
|
|
...
INCLUINDO PROJETO METADADO
Card |
---|
| Incluindo Projeto Metadados: Esta opção possibilitará inclusão do projetos para criação do metadado no sistema pre definido. Para realizar o processo siga as orientações disponibilizadas no exemplo abaixo. Image Modified |
|
|
...
Informações |
---|
| Na criação do projeto de metadados, é necessário incluir um ID de Segurança único para o projeto. |
|
Card |
---|
| Acessando o Metadado Criado: 1º Passo: Será necessário a Liberação de acesso para o usuário: Após a inclusão do Metadado deverá ser disponibilizado a permissão para o usuário acessar o mesmo no sistema. Esta parametrização é necessária pelo fato do recurso (Metadados) criar outros menus no sistema o que ficará até o momento bloqueado para o usuário. Neste caso realize o processo: |
|
|
...
Acesse o perfil ao qual este usuário possui as permissões selecionando o contexto ao qual refere-se o processo: Image Modified |
|
|
Informações |
---|
title | Para maiores informações: |
---|
|
Consulte o WikiHelp TOTVS
Image Removed COMUNIDADE R@TBC e Microsoft Dynamics CRM
Canais de Atendimento:
Chamado: Através do Portal Totvs www.suporte.totvs.com.br
Telefônico: 4003-0015 Escolhendo as opções 2 – (Software), 2 – (Suporte Técnico), 3 – (RM), 9 – (Demais Áreas), 4 – (BI) e 3 – (Gerador de Relatórios e Planilha). Em seguida será possível acessar o seu projeto. |
|
|